WW2 British Entrenching Tool
This was a WWII British entrenching tool which was a piece of equipment issued to soldiers for a variety of essential tasks. Typically consisting of a metal spade blade attached to a sturdy wooden handle, this tool was designed for digging defensive trenches, foxholes, and other fortifications quickly and efficiently.
